What are the early symptoms of lung cancer

What are the early symptoms of lung cancer

Cough is one of the most common symptoms of lung cancer. This cough is characterized by irritation. As the disease progresses, the patient will cough up sputum, and blood will appear in the sputum. This can be said to be one of the typical symptoms of lung cancer. In addition, patients with early and middle stage lung cancer will also have a certain degree of chest tightness and chest pain, but it is not obvious. The following is a detailed introduction to the symptoms of lung cancer:

1. Hemoptysis

Half of lung cancer patients have this symptom. If a male smoker over 40 years old has blood in his sputum, blood streaks or small blood clots, the possibility of lung cancer is quite high, and coughing up blood is one of the early symptoms of lung cancer.

2. Cough

This is the most common early symptom of lung cancer, and most lung cancer patients have this symptom. It can be a mild dry cough or a severe cough, with varying amounts of sputum. However, in lung cancer patients with chronic long-term coughs, if the nature of the cough changes, or the frequency of coughing increases or the cough occurs at night, they should be alert to lung cancer.

3. Chest tightness and shortness of breath

This is also a common early symptom of lung cancer. In addition to the lung cancer tumor blocking the bronchus and causing atelectasis and lung inflammation which can cause chest tightness and shortness of breath, it is generally more obvious in the late stages of lung cancer, especially when a large amount of pleural effusion is present.

4. Chest pain

Forty percent of lung cancer patients may experience pulmonary chest pain, which is generally intermittent and mild chest pain. It manifests as dull pain or drilling pain, and this symptom can last from minutes to hours. This is also one of the early symptoms of lung cancer.

The symptoms of early lung cancer are not obvious and not specific, which is similar to most other malignant tumors. Generally, the symptoms are those of respiratory diseases, which are not easy to identify. Therefore, it is recommended that if elderly people have symptoms of respiratory diseases, do not be careless and go to a regular professional hospital for diagnosis in time.
